ALERT: Graphline visualizer render failures

The Graphline dependency graph visualizer is returning blank canvases for projects with more than 500 nodes. Root cause appears to be a layout-engine timeout introduced in last week's deploy. Support: advise affected users to use the list view as a workaround. Triage steps and current status are on the page below.

dashboard of badup-kafog = https://grafana.norvatech.test/browse

### v2.7.1 — Occupancy Feed Fix

Corrected a drift issue in the Stallhaven garage occupancy feed where sensor heartbeats were double-counted during shift changeovers, inflating reported capacity by up to 9%. Historical counts from the affected window were reprocessed overnight. Support should direct any lingering discrepancy reports to the feed maintainer named below.

approver of faduf-bagug = Framir Sorwyn

Handover Note — Records Team

The notarised deed for the Wexmoor parcel is in the red folio in drawer three, sealed and stamped. Copy already scanned to the registry file. Original goes out tomorrow via Stonegate Couriers; do not fold or re-staple it. Sign the transfer ledger at collection. When the courier presents their badge, relay the instruction set out directly below.

handover note for yagef-bagep: the drudor pelius courier leaves the kasdor zorvan norir ledger at gate 8016 under passcode 755406

## Build Provenance: RemindLoop Nightly Job

The RemindLoop appointment reminder job for Harrowfield Clinic is built from the `reminder-core` tag pipeline only. Future maintainers should never deploy from local builds; the dispatcher verifies the signed manifest at startup and refuses unverified artifacts. Each deployment record links the compiler version, dependency lockfile hash, and the pipeline run. The token for the current production build is recorded below.

trace token, fafog-kageg: htk4_98e6